问如何使用Arduino的Serial.println打印带有浮点数的字符串EN该红外远程库由两部分组成:IRsend发送IR远程数据包,而IRrecv接收和解码IR消息。IRsend使用连接到输出引脚3的红外LED。要发送消息,请针对所需协议调用send方法,其中包含要发送的数据和要发送的位数。该examples/IRsendDemo草图提供了如何发送代码一个简单的例子:
字符串类型(String、char数组等) 使用Serial.print()函数时,需要根据要打印的变量类型选择相应的参数类型,以确保正确输出。例如,如果要打印一个整数变量x,可以使用Serial.print(x);如果要打印一个浮点数变量y,可以使用Serial.print(y);如果要打印一个字符变量c,可以使用Serial.print(c);如果要打印一个字符串变量st...
ros::Publisher pub = ros::Node::get()->advertise<std_msgs::String>("chatter", 1000); // 定义一个回调函数来处理接收到的ROS消息 ros::Rate loop_rate(10); while (ros::Node::get()->ok()) { // 发布ROS消息 std_msgs::String msg; msg.data = "Hello, ROS1!"; pub.publish(msg); ...
("Sent: {}", String::from_utf8_lossy(data_to_send)); // 接收数据 let mut buffer = [0u8; 128]; let bytes_read = port.read(&mut buffer)?; let received_data = String::from_utf8_lossy(&buffer[..bytes_read]); println!("Received: {}", received_data); Ok(()) } ...
; #ifARX_HAVE_LIBSTDCPLUSPLUS >= 201103L//Have libstdc++11//Log containersstd::vector<int> vs {1,2,3}; std::deque<float> ds {1.1,2.2,3.3}; std::map<String,int> ms {{"one",1}, {"two",2}, {"three",3}};PRINTLN("Containers can also be printed like", vs, ds, ms); ...
println!("cargo:rustc-linker=flip-link"); } fn generate_vial_config() { // Generated vial config file let out_file = Path::new(&env::var_os("OUT_DIR").unwrap()).join("config_generated.rs"); let p = Path::new("vial.json"); let mut content = String::new(); match File::...
Serial.begin(115200); } void loop() { delay(50); Serial.println("Voltage = "+String(...
// Set the rosserial socket server IP addressIPAddressserver(192,168,1,1);// Set the rosserial socket server portconstuint16_t serverPort=11411;ros::NodeHandle nh;// Make a chatter publisherstd_msgs::String str_msg;ros::Publisherchatter("chatter",&str_msg);// Be polite and say hello...
所以我用kryoSerialzation在我的redisTemplates上,当你有你的网站或应用程序启动和运行一个域的背后,则是经常需要还允许用户通过简单的域名访问到它,并在WWW子域名。也就是说,他们应该可以使用或不使用“ www.”前缀访问您的域名,例如,example.com或者www.example.com在Web浏览器中,并显示相同的内容。虽然有...
我对arduino nano的代码是:人们希望学习批处理命令的一个普遍原因是要得到批处理强大的功能。如果你希望...